Practical Seller Notes
Before publishing any listing featuring Mom of the Year, test it on real mockups. Preview it as a marketplace thumbnail and check how it looks on both white and dark backgrounds. Test print colors to ensure they match your expectations and verify PNG transparency if you plan to layer it over other images.
Inspect SVG cut quality if you're using it for Cricut or Silhouette projects, and confirm file resolution for print-on-demand services. Organize files clearly for customers and pair it with complementary font styles such as serif, sans serif, script, or display fonts to enhance the final product.
Lastly, always confirm commercial licensing before selling finished products to avoid any legal issues down the line.
